UNPACKING CARTON (See Fig. 2)

CAUTION: Be careful of exposed staples when handling or disposing of cartoning material.

IMPORTANT: WHEN UNPACKING AND ASSEMBLING TILLER, BE CAREFUL NOT TO STRETCH OR KINK CABLES.

While holding handle assembly, cut cable ties securing handle assembly to top frame. Let handle assembly rest on tiller.

Remove top frame of carton.

Slowly ease handle assembly up and place on top of carton.

Cut down right hand front and right hand rear corners of carton, lay side carton wall down.

Remove packing material from handle assembly.

INSTALL HANDLE (See Figs. 3, 4, and 5)

Insert one handle lock (with teeth facing outward) in gearcase notch. (Apply grease on smooth side of handle lock to aid in keeping lock in place until handle assembly is lowered into position.)

Grasp handle assembly. Hold in “up” position. Be sure handle lock remains in gearcase notch. Slide handle assembly into position.

Rotate handle assembly down. Insert rear carriage bolt first, with bolt head on L.H. side of tiller and loosely assemble locknut (See Fig. 5).

Insert pivot bolt in front part of plate and tighten.

Cut down remaining corners of carton and lay panels flat.

Lower the handle assembly. Tighten nut on carriage bolt bolt so handle moves with some resistance. This will allow for easier adjustment.

Place flat washer on threaded end of handle lock le- ver.

Insert handle lock lever through handle base and gearcase. Screw in handle lock lever just enough to hold lever in place.

Insert second handle lock (with teeth inward) in the slot of the handle base (just inside of washer).

With handle assembly in lowest position, securely tighten handle lock lever by rotating clockwise. Leav- ing handle assembly in lowest position will make it easier to remove tiller from carton.
